Mahabharata Udyoga Parva – बरह्मास्यतॊ बराह्मणाः संप्रसूता; बाहुभ्यां वै क्षत्रियाः संप्रसूताः

Shloka (श्लोक)
बरह्मास्यतॊ बराह्मणाः संप्रसूता; बाहुभ्यां वै क्षत्रियाः संप्रसूताः
नाभ्यां वैश्याः पादतश चापि शूद्राः; सर्वे वर्णा नान्यथा वेदितव्याः
⚡ Quick Meaning
All four castes originate from Brahman; each has a unique role within society.
Translations
English Translation
The Brahmins arise from the head of Brahman, the Kshatriyas from the shoulders, the Vaishyas from the thighs, and the Shudras from the feet. Thus, each caste has its distinct purpose, with the understanding that there’s no other way to comprehend this structure.
